Matty,
In Australia the quoted octane at the pump is the RON (Research Octane Number). Our American friends have their fuel quoted with what we call the AKI (Anti Knock Index). That is (RON + MON)/2 Normal MON (Motor Octane Number) is around the 88 mark. |
